How does the bookmark function work?

The bookmark function is designed to remember where your employees left off in their training should they get interupted while taking a course and have to leave it before taking the final exam. When the employee logs in and enters their employee name, it will provide him/her the option of restarting the course from the beginning or continuing where he/she left off.

 


Back to Top

Why didn't the bookmark function work?

Because it uses the local computer's internet cache/memory to store the bookmark data, the bookmark function is computer-specific. This means that if a student leaves off on a course at a computer at work and logs in onto that same course at a home computer later that night, the bookmark will not remember course progresss from the work computer. The employee must use the same PC for it to remember any unfinished course progress. (However, courses are 100% fully operational from any internet-connected computer in the world.)

In addition, the bookmark remembers individual course progress by using the employees name as it is spelled. If an employee mispells his/her name or rearranges his/her name entry, the bookmark will not work. Please advise employees to type in their name the same time everytime they log in.

How do I retake a course?

After a course is completed, quiz and exam answers remain recorded as part of the bookmark function. If you are access the course from a course menu, simply opt for the "Retake course from the beginning" option when you enter your name.

However, if you are already in a course and would like to retake it, simply hit the "CLEAR" button located on the bottom right of the course under the course navigation bar. Then, refresh the page by hitting the refresh button at the top of your browser. This will erase any previously answered data and allow you to retake the course.

What is the Test Out Function?

The Test Out function allows you to skip past course content and go directly to the course final exam. This is offered as an alternative for experienced financial institution employees who may already have a firm grasp of the topics covered in the programming and simply want to take the final exam. If at any point, the employee changes his/her mind and decides to view course content, he/she can simply use the navigation bar to the right of the course to pick an entry point into the study material.

Why can't I view the video content?

There are several reasons why this may happen.

One, your bank's IT department may have set certain restrictions that do not allow for any video content viewing from your institution's computers. A good way to check this is to go to a site such as YouTube or Hulu and see if you can see any video content from that page. If not, your IT department may need to make some adjustments to the internet security/restrictions to allow for video playback.

Two, your internet connection and/or computer capabilities may not meet the minimums needed for playback. Please go to our Technical Requirements page to view system requirements and to use a free tool to test your internet connection speed.

Three, you may need to download the latest version of Adobe Flash Player. If this is the case, you will be prompted to do so when you log into a course. Follow the instructions to install the player.

How do I prevent my employees from cheating?

Because our final exams are based on content learned from the video content, it is impossible to print out course content and refer to it to answer questions. In addition, because course content is engaging, award-winning video with interactive elements, employees are less likely to want to find shortcuts.

Once answers are registered for quizzes and exams, the answers registered are locked and can not be changed. This prevents the student from backtracking and simply "clicking their way" to the correct answer. If an employee fails a course, they are able to go in and retake the course from the beginning.
